PAW PAW, MI (WHTC) – State police investigators have wrapped up their probe of the 193-vehicle fatal pileup on I-94 near Climax on January 9th. A total of 63 drivers will be ticketed in the incident that claimed the life of 57-year-old Canadian trucker Jean Larocque and injured 23 others, including five first responders.
The highway was closed in both directions for two days as a result of the crash. Troopers say that drivers going too fast for wintry conditions at the time was the primary cause of the pileup.
